BIRMINGHAM ANJUMAN-E-ISLAM MASJID TRUST 

To advance the religion of Islam by means of, but not exclusively. To arrange or help in the provision of facility for Islamic Worship, Islamic Education, Celebration of Islamic Festivals, Marriages, Burials in accordance with the teaching of the Quran and the Sunnah of the Prophet Muhammed (Peace be Upon Him) as interpreted by the Sunni Deobandi School of Thought.
